忽略前两个特殊字符,然后抓住所有内容

时间:2013-11-05 05:34:51

标签: jquery regex

我所处理的问题的性质如下所述:

我的字符串类似radiobutton1_2_3_4imagelist_1_34_54

我想做的是在第三个下划线(_)之后抓住所有内容。

id.substring(id.indexOf('_')我试过这个,但就我而言,它没有用。

此致

1 个答案:

答案 0 :(得分:1)

如果它始终是最后一个下划线,则可以使用id.substring(id.lastIndexOf('_')),否则id.split('_')[3]应该有效。

var split = id.split('_');
var a = split[1], b = split[2], c = split[3];

这会将你的三个数字存储在a,b,c